PTC Creo Interactive Surface Design Extension II
 
delivers the ultimate integration of 3D design and engineering. By combining the power of parametric modeling with the flexibility of free- form surfacing, you can now create complex, freeform curves and surfaces directly within a single, intuitive and interactive design environment.

PTC Creo Interactive Surface Design Extension II combines industry-leading free-form surfacing tools within the modeling environment of PTC. Designers and engineers can create conceptual designs and free-form surfaces while having the ability to model the specific engineered components essential in every successful product. This way they can not only utilize the power of free-form surfacing, but also to leverage rich functionality – such as behavioral modeling, drafting, simulation, and manufacturing – from within a single application, making PTC Creo the ultimate solution for product.

Capabilities and Specifications


Curve creation

  • Reuse curves from PTC Creo Sketch in Style
  • Create 3D curves by specifying interpolation or control points in one or more views
  • Set up references dynamically by snapping to any object
  • Create planar curves referencing a plane or radial to another curve
  • Create curves directly on surfaces (COS), or projected
  • Create style curve copies of imported or native curves/edges
  • Create isoline curves
  • Offset COS

Curve edit

  • Full control over the degree of the curve
  • Move control points dynamically or numerically
  • Edit multiple curves simultaneously
  • View original curve while editing
  • Interactively delete or change references to any object
  • Modify tangent constraints dynamically or numerically
  • Connect curves and surfaces with positional, tangent, draft and curvature continuity
  • Add interpolation or control points interactively
  • Delete individual points or curve segments
  • Combine and split curves
  • View dynamic curve and surface analysis
  • Change curve types between Free, Planar or COS
  • Unlink curves and individual points from references
  • Accurately adjust and fine-tune curves
  • Partially constrain curves

Surface creation

  • Easily create surfaces with support for n-sided surfaces and re-parameterization of surfaces
  • Degree of surface defined by degree of curves
  • Regenerate surfaces in real-time
  • Make automatic surface connections
  • Reshape surfaces by editing the defining curves
  • Add or remove multiple internal curves
  • Replace boundary curves/edges to redefine surface shape
  • Change surface types between boundary, loft, and blend while maintaining all references
  • Trim surfaces

Surface edit

  • Full control over the degree and multiplicity of the surface
  • Manipulate surfaces faster with direct surface editing
  • Edit and control the surface math with multi resolution control point editing

Connections

View surface connections interactively to define the following:

  • G0 Positional
  • G1 Tangent
  • G2 Curvature continuous
  • Establish leader/follower relationships (G1 or G2)

Modeling environment

  • Work within a four-view window
  • Reference defining geometry such as points, planes, axes, curves, surfaces, and solids
  • Create reference geometry asynchronously while modeling
  • Work directly off imported geometry or facet data
  • Drive model changes through parametric modifications
  • Benefits from downstream use of additional geometry creation, engineering, simulation, optimization and manufacturing
